Job Posting End Date: 02/04 Unum is a company of people serving people. As one of the world's leading employee benefits providers and a Fortune 500 company, Unum's financial protection benefits help protect more than 33 million working people and their families from the financial impact of illness or injury. Unum's three distinct, but similarly focused US businesses - Unum US, Colonial Life, and Starmount Life - are each a market leader in making disability, life, accident, critical illness, dental, and vision insurance accessible in the workplace. Headquartered in Chattanooga, Tennessee, Unum has significant US operations in Portland, Maine, Worcester, Massachusetts, and Glendale, California with over 35 field offices nationwide. Colonial Life is headquartered in Columbia, South Carolina with over 40 field offices nationwide. Starmount Life is based in Baton Rouge, Louisiana, and is the dental and vision center of excellence for Unum in the US. General Summary: A software engineer is a member of an Agile development team that employs Scrum as the process management framework, working to drive features from idea to completion in order to deliver business value. Software engineers develop and maintain distributed applications using the .NET Framework, utilizing technologies like MVC and Web Api. In addition, they produce progressive and responsive user interfaces for the web using HTML5, JavaScript and CSS. They support deployments to production and troubleshoot issues that may arise, often developing creative solutions in a time-limited and challenging environment. They debug, identify and fix code defects and support production applications as part of an on-call rotation. Software engineers use source control systems like TFS, Git or Subversion to check-in, branch and shelve code changes. They integrate SOA or REST services for use in distributed applications via a service layer architecture. They design database schemas to fit the needs of an enterprise business application and write database update scripts, stored procedures, functions and views for SQL Server. Software engineers create automated build and deployment jobs using software like Jenkins or TFS to facilitate Continuous Integration and Continuous Delivery. Software Engineer is responsible for the building and/or configuration of software solutions within their business portfolio. They ensure software is delivered to high quality standards by collaborating with their agile team members and by leveraging unit testing and continuous integration. They participate in the estimation of work required to deliver software features.
